Who We Are Looking For:
Phoenix Tailings is looking for a hands-on, driven, and curious Production Engineer II to join our team and help scale the first clean production of rare earth and critical metals. This role is embedded directly into the operations of our first of a kind rare earth metal production facility in Exeter, Nh As a core member of our production team, you’ll be responsible for running, improving, and scaling next-generation metal processing equipment. You’ll work shoulder-to-shoulder with operators, engineers, and leadership to ensure safe, efficient, and high-quality production of materials essential to the modern economy.
Key Responsibilities:
- Operate, monitor, and support daily production of clean rare earth and critical metals
- Conduct process checks, equipment adjustments, and in-line quality verification to maintain production targets
- Troubleshoot mechanical and operational issues to minimize downtime and improve reliability
- Collect and analyze production data to identify trends and support continuous improvement
- Assist in implementing new processes and scaling up pilot operations to commercial throughput
- Lead or contribute to process improvement initiatives focused on safety, throughput, and efficiency
- Perform safe startup, shutdown, and changeover of production systems in coordination with plant leadership
- Work closely with shift leads and operators to ensure consistent, high-performance operation
- Contribute to the development of standard operating procedures and training documentation
- Enforce and promote best practices in safety and environmental compliance

Phoenix Tailings is a rare earth metals production company dedicated to restoring U.S. industrial independence by building domestic refining capacity. The company aims to redefine the industry as the first fully clean mining and metals producer, using sustainable, net-zero technology to transform mining waste (tailings) into critical rare earth metals and alloys essential for modern technology, defense, and green energy infrastructure.
